High-flown
Pronunciation : High"-flown`
Part of Speech : a.
Definition : 1. Elevated; proud. "High-flown hopes." Denham.
2. Turgid; extravagant; bombastic; inflated; as, high-flown language. M. Arnold.
Source : Webster's Unabridged Dictionary, 1913
